Just a quick post to introduce myself. I'm a kayak guide working for Descanso Beach Ocean Sports and joined this forum primarily to get some help identifying the strange creatures I've encountered kayaking around the west side of Santa Catalina island, like this strange helical ribbon like gelatinous creature that was about 2 meters long:

When Jake described it to me yesterday, I thought it might have been one of the siphonophores (Apolemia or Praya) but seeing these images, it is the oral arms of a jellyfish separated from the bell.
